Title : 
Static output-feedback stabilization for time-delay Takagi-Sugeno fuzzy systems

            Abstract : 
The static output-feedback control of fuzzy models is one of the most challenging problems in the fuzzy control field. In this paper, an approach to design a static output-feedback control for discrete-time-delay fuzzy models is proposed. Based on a quadratic Lyapunov function, sufficient conditions in terms of bilinear matrix inequalities (BMIs) are derived for asymptotic stability. To design a static output-feedback stabilizing controller, sufficient conditions are formulated into a set of linear matrix inequalities using some matrix transformations, which make possible to calculate directly the desired controller. A numerical example is given to illustrate the applicability of the proposed approach.
